Beschrijving Lecture Notes in Statistics: Branching Processes and Related Fields

This volume comprises a selection of papers originally presented at the 6th International Workshop on Branching Processes and Their Applications (IWBPA24), held from April 8 to 12, 2024, in Badajoz, Spain. The contributions cover a broad spectrum of both theoretical and applied topics within the field of branching process theory. Together, they highlight the ongoing vitality and significance of this research area--not only in advancing core mathematical theory but also in tackling emerging challenges across diverse applied fields such as Epidemiology, Biology, Genetics, and Population Dynamics.

The topics explored in this volume can be broadly categorized into the following areas:

1. Markovian and non-Markovian branching trees

2. Branching processes in Biology, Genetics, and Epidemiology

3. Multitype and infinite-type branching processes

4. Branching random walks

5. Special branching models

6. Statistical inference in branching processes

Serving as a valuable resource for current research, this volume also identifies numerous open problems, paving the way for future developments in both theoretical and applied contexts.
